Meet my new phone.
I’d been considering buying a new phone for a while now. My old Treo 650 (As pictured here) was starting to wind down, the battery was losing it’s charge and the select button was getting a bit stiff and there were a lot of grazes where I’d dropped it numerous times in the last couple of years. But still, it was working and an upgrade seemed unnecessary.
The other thing stopping my from upgrading was that I’d be dealing with a new operating system. I’ve been using Palm OS for years, from my very first PDA, A Clie SJ22 and then my Clie UX50 and onto my Treo. I had collected all the programs I liked over the years and now I’d have to find all new ones for WM6 if I were to upgrade.
Anyway – I did upgrade, and I’ve found a few replacement programs. Still a couple to find though.
But all in all – I loves me new phone.
